Estimated Time:

5 Minutes

Materials:

  • 14x3 HWH SDS2 410 (stainless steel tek-screw), Fastenal Part #: 31965
  • Fender washer: 1/4” X 1-1/4”, SS (165-01111)
  • LG Chem RESU 10H battery bracket

Tools:

  • Milwaukee drill
  • 3/16” x 6” HSS extension drill
  • Milwaukee impact driver
  • 5/16” nut setter
  • LG Chem RESU 10H battery handles (094-10000)

7 of 17

  • Level out and mark the location on the wall for your penetration points, highlighted in yellow.

  • Per LG, the battery must be installed with the following clearances:
    • Top = 12”
    • Left and Right = 12”
    • Bottom = 24”

IMPORTANT: When the battery is installed, it will drop past the bottom edge of the bracket by at least 10”.

8 of 17

  • Mark two penetrations in each of the four numbered areas marked at the right.

  • Make sure that the penetrations for Areas 1, 2, 3, and 4 are clear of the bracket’s lip, circled in red. This will allow you to drop the battery in place with ease and will also allow the bracket and battery to line up so that you can secure the (2) M6 wall mount bolts.

9 of 17

  • Use a drill with the 3/16” x 6” HSS extension Drill to make your pilot holes.

NOTE: Do not penetrate through the metal framing with the extension drill.

  • Use a drill with 3/16” x 6” HSS extension drill to penetrate into the wall lightly so that you can feel the tip of the extension drill make contact with the metal framing.

  • FYI: The Tek-Screws are designed to drill through the metal framing and fasten at the same time.

10 of 17

  • After pilot holes are all drilled, use an impact driver with 5/16” nut setter to secure the Tek screws in place.

  • Use the 1/4” X 1-1/4” fender washer with the Tek screws. Make sure not to over-torque!

12 of 17

BE CAREFUL WHEN LIFTING THE BATTERY - Stretch-and-flex first!!!

  • The LG Chem RESU10H Battery weighs 214lbs.

  • Most crews will need 3 people in order to safely lift the battery. (one person on each side, and one in front).

  • Make sure to use the LG Battery handles to help with lifting. You can MRF these from the SIS Product Portfolio (094-10000).

NOTE: You’ll need to lift the battery higher than the bracket’s lip in order to successfully secure the battery in place.

13 of 17

  • Make sure that the battery rests onto the battery bracket’s lip (see image below).

  • The LG Chem RESU 10H Battery comes with (2) M6 wall mount bolts.

  • Secure each of these bolts on the left side of the battery. (see images)
